About this landmark

Georgian mansion and National Historic Landmark. Home of George Rogers Clark's sister. Hosted Lewis and Clark after their famous expedition. Louisville's oldest existing farmstead.

Historic Locust Grove is a 55-acre 18th-century farm site and National Historic Landmark situated in eastern Jefferson County, Kentucky in what is now Louisville. The site is owned by the Louisville Metro government, and operated as a historic interpretive site by Historic Locust Grove, Inc.
